Revised, rerefined crystal structure of PDB entry 2QHK, methyl accepting chemotaxis protein
Template:ABSTRACT PUBMED 22705207
About this Structure
4exo is a 1 chain structure with sequence from Vibrio parahaemolyticus. Full crystallographic information is available from OCA.
